    I think a lot of the confusion over Cetus standing cap comes from the traders' UI when handing over gems or fish.  It will tell you the most you can currently get which will be the lesser of:

    Your daily cap of (1+MR)x1,000.

    The cap for your current tier.

    In my case I can get 25,000 per day but unless I spend some during the day or rank up I can only get about 5,000 more.  The traders tell me I can only currently get 5,000 because at that moment that's all I can get.  If I back out, buy something and go back to offer them stuff the limit will have risen by the amount I just spent (unless the daily cap kicks in).
